Not a big fan of the 9mm, but with XTP or Gold Dot 124gr +P ammo it should do the job under a 100m I would think.
 
Shot my first coyote with one, it will do the job out to 100 yds or so with 90-115 grn +P or +P+ like Rem or Magtech which it is rated for. Use expanding ammo, no FMJ, and a red dot scope on it would help. I got rid of mine, but I may buy one back because they are fun to shoot and very reliable.
